#0bb185 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#0bb185 is composed of 4.3% red, 69.4%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.9%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 164.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 36.9%. #0bb185 color hex could be obtained by blending #16ffff with #00630b.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

● #0bb185 color description : Dark c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#0bb185 has RGB values of R:11, G:177,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 766341.
